AI-powered humanoid robot named CEO of Chinese video game company in world first A CHINESE video game company has appointed the world's first robotic CEO. The AI -powered female bot, named 'Ms. Tang Yu', will be at the helm of NetDragon Websoft's main subsidiary, Fujian. The robot will be a top executive at the company valued at nearly $10billion. NetDragon Websoft expects their robo-CEO to maintain a diverse set of key responsibilities while driving the company forward.
